Reconstruction of Hanna Avenue is complete at last. If you’ve visited campus over the past two years, you know the street’s been festooned with orange barrels and heavy equipment for what seems like an eternity to the campus community. Once the work was largely finished, workers took on the specially designed median, which features landscaping, large planters, and clearly delineated crosswalks that match the look of the outer sidewalks, where antique-style lampposts have replaced unsightly utility poles. A ribbon-cutting December 1 celebrated the occasion.
